Easy hiking trails around Gaildorf offer access to the diverse landscapes of Germany's Schwäbisch Hall district. The region features rolling hills, lush meadows, and scenic valleys, providing varied terrain for outdoor exploration. Gaildorf is situated within the Limpurger Berge and near the Schwäbisch-Fränkischer Forest Nature Park, characterized by its natural environments and river valleys. The area's elevation changes are generally gentle, making it suitable for easy walks.

Gaildorf offers a wide selection of easy hiking trails, with over 80 routes specifically categorized as easy. In total, there are more than 140 hiking routes in the area, catering to various preferences.
Yes, many easy trails around Gaildorf are perfect for families. The region's gentle elevation changes and well-maintained paths make them accessible. For example, the Gaildorf Castle Park – Kocher River Trail loop from Gaildorf is a pleasant option, offering a mix of park scenery and riverside walking.
Most easy hiking trails in Gaildorf are dog-friendly, allowing you to enjoy the scenic landscapes with your canine companion. It's always recommended to keep dogs on a leash, especially in nature reserves or near livestock, and to follow local regulations. The paths through the Limpurger Berge and along the Kocher River are generally suitable.
Easy hikes around Gaildorf showcase diverse natural features, including rolling hills, lush meadows, and scenic river valleys like the Kocher and Jagst. You can also explore parts of the Schwäbisch-Fränkischer Forest Nature Park. The Viewing platform Druckele – Kirgelsattel loop from Gaildorf offers views of the surrounding landscape.
Yes, several easy trails pass by interesting historical landmarks. You can explore the Old Town and Castle of Gaildorf, or visit the Lammbräu Brewery Inn and Fach Castle. The Kochersteg Covered Bridge – Kerner Tower loop from Gaildorf takes you past the historic Kochersteg Covered Bridge and to the Kerner Tower, which offers panoramic views.
The best seasons for easy hiking in Gaildorf are spring and autumn. Spring brings blooming flowers and mild temperatures, while autumn offers vibrant foliage. Both seasons provide comfortable conditions and beautiful scenery for exploring the trails.
Yes, Gaildorf has numerous easy circular hiking routes. Many trails are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Viewing platform Druckele – Kirgelsattel loop from Gaildorf and the Haspel Lake – Haspelsee Picnic and Rest Area loop from Herschel.

Absolutely. The region is known for its scenic vistas. The Kochersteg Covered Bridge – Kerner Tower loop from Gaildorf leads to the Kerner Tower, which provides magnificent panoramic views of Gaildorf and Schwäbisch Hall. The Viewing platform Druckele – Kirgelsattel loop from Gaildorf also includes a viewing platform.
The easy trails in Gaildorf are highly regarded by the komoot community, with an average rating of 4.6 stars from nearly 500 reviews. Hikers often praise the well-maintained paths, the diverse natural scenery, and the accessibility of the routes for all skill levels.
Yes, there are several short and easy walks perfect for beginners or those looking for a quick stroll. For instance, the Haspel Lake – Haspelsee Picnic and Rest Area loop from Feuchtgebiet am Stielbach is a short 2.9 km route with minimal elevation gain, ideal for a relaxed outing.
